Runway09 does not have ILS.
 

Saw the map. The proper name is Ngurah Rai International Airport though TV news casters call it Denpasar Airport. Runway is 8,858 feet or 2,700 m. Changi Airport runway is 4,000m.

The FLIR we used on airborne EO sensor package is able to penetrate cloud cover and precipitation in Mid-Wavelength Infrared (MWIR) and Long-Wavelength Infrared (LWIR) with a white hot display output.
